|
Syllabus |
Duration of Module (Hrs) |
Session 1: |
Introduction Of Cloud Computing |
2 Hours |
· Cloud computing concepts |
· IaaS, PaaS and SaaS |
· Public Cloud vs Private Cloud |
· Introduction to Virtualization |
· Server virtualization & Desktop Virtualization |
· Cloud Storage |
· Horizontal vs. vertical scaling |
· Introduction to AWS and AZURE |
· Introduction to AWS |
· How to create free tier account in AWS |
· Basic Commands of linux |
|
|
|
|
Session 2: |
Networking Part 1 |
2 Hours |
· Basic Of Networking |
· Subnetting |
· Private Subnet Vs Public Subnet |
· What is VPC |
|
|
|
Session 3: |
Networking Part 2 |
2 Hours |
· VPC configuration |
· Internet Gateway |
· Inbound and outbound ACL's |
· VPC Peering |
· NAT Gateways |
|
|
|
Session 4: |
EC2 Instance |
2 Hours |
· Understanding EC2 |
· Launching your first AWS instance |
· On-demand Instance pricing |
· Reserved Instance pricing |
· Spot instance pricing |
· Security groups |
· AMI |
· Key Pairs |
· Elastic IP's |
· Create EBS volumes |
· Delete EBS Volumes |
· Attach and detach EBS volumes |
· Mounting and un-mounting EBS volume |
· Creating and deleting snapshots |
· Creating volumes from snapshots |
|
|
|
Session 5: |
CloudWatch |
2 Hours |
· Cloudwatch dashboard |
· Configuring Monitoring services |
· Setting thresholds |
· Configuring actions |
· Creating a cloudwatch alarm |
· Getting statistics for ec2 instances |
· Monitoring other AWS services |
Simple Notification Service (SNS) |
· what is SNS? |
· Creating a topic |
|
· Create subscription |
|
· Subscribed to the subscription |
|
|
|
Session 6: |
AutoScaling and LoadBalancer |
2 Hours |
· Boot strapping |
· Create a launch configuration |
· Create an Auto Scaling group |
· Create a policy for your Auto Scaling group |
· set up an auto-scaled, load-balanced |
· Amazon EC2 application |
· LoadBalancer Type |
· Target Group |
· Classic LoadBalancer Vs Network LoadBalancer Vs Application LoadBalancer |
· Configuration Of LoadBalancer |
|
|
|
Session 7: |
S3 (Simple Storage Service) |
2 Hours |
· what is S3? |
· S3 Infrequent Access storage |
· S3 durability and redundancy |
· S3 Buckets |
· S3 Uploading Downloading |
· S3 Permissions |
· S3 Object Versioning |
· S3 Lifecycle Policies |
· Glacier storage |
|
|
|
|
Session 8: |
Identity access management (IAM) & AWS CLI Configuration |
2 Hours |
· Creating Users and Groups |
· Applying policies |
· Password Policy |
· Roles |
· Practical Demo |
· AWS CLI configuration on your local machine and on EC2 Instance |
CloudFront |
· Use of cloudfront |
· Creating a cloudfront distribution |
· Hosting a website of cloudfront distribution |
· Implementing restrictions |
|
|
|
Session 9: |
Relational Database Service (RDS) |
2 Hours |
· Selecting the Database type |
· Configuring the database |
· Creating database |
· Configuring backups |
· Configuring the maintenance windows |
· Connecting to the database. |
Dynamo DB |
· Creating a Dynamo db |
· Configuring alarms |
· Adding data manually |
|
|
|
Session 10: |
Route53 |
2 Hours |
· Creating zones |
· Hosting a website |
· Understanding routing policies |
· Weighted simple and failover policies |
Elastic Beanstalk |
· Creating environment |
· Application versioning |
· Deploying a sample app |
|
|
|
Session 11: |
Cloud Formation |
2 Hours |
· What is cloud formation? |
· Deploying template |
· Create Stack |
· Delete Stack |
· Provisioning application resources with |
· CloudFormation |
· Monitoring the resources |
|
|
|
Session 12: |
AWS Lambda and API |
2 Hours |
· Getting started with AWS Lambda |
· Introduction to API |
· Understanding working of API |
· Building our API with API Gateway |
|
|
|
Session 13: |
VPN (Virtual Private Network) |
2 Hours |
· Introduction Of VPN |
· Customer Gateways |
· Virtual Private Gateways |
· Site-to-Site VPN Connections |
|
|
|
Session 14: |
Security Components |
2 Hours |
· Understanding of Guard Duty |
· Understanding of AWS Inspector |
· Understanding of AWS WAF |
|
|
|
|
Session 15: |
SQS (Simple Queue Service) |
2 Hours |
· Queue Configuration |
· FiFO and Standard Queue |
AWS troubleshooting |
· Troubleshooting EC2 instances |
· Troubleshooting using CloudWatch |
· Troubleshooting using ELB |
· Using CloudTrail |